Pros

flexible hours fully remote company

Cons

ancient, outdated technology (some code in production was written in 2002 or earlier) hourly pay management is entirely promoted from within and don't really know what they are doing will throw employees under the bus to protect the "old boys club" unwilling to invest in technical debt (there is a lot of vb, vanilla js, angular 1, .net 4.6 and only 1 repo in .net core 3.1 and nothing newer) nepotism the founder of the company has no idea how to code, yet continues to do so, adding to his 20k+ lines per file with variables like "var_a" extremely poor project management no agile processes at all siloing on projects with SMEs who don't respond to chat

Pros

Able to learn a lot about call routing and contact center technologies and build those systems out (configuration and implementation work). Good healthcare plan.

Cons

Integration specialists have to not only do implementation work / installs, but also basically work in a call center as tech support when they aren't doing installs. Not great incentives, as the pay increase is really just a 5-7% increase per year, even if you are doing an awesome job. They don't call their employees engineers even though they are... this makes it harder for current employees to find similar jobs on the market to compare their job against. Have to be on call every few weeks. One person stays on call for an entire week, pretty much killing any plans you have.
